Gov Mohammed Clarifies Criticism of Tinubu’s Policies, Emphasizes Constructive Intent

-

Bauchi State Governor, Senator Bala Abdulkadir Mohammed, has clarified that his recent critique of certain federal government policies is not politically motivated.

In a statement issued by his Special Adviser on Media and Publicity, Mukhtar Gidado, Governor Mohammed reaffirmed his support for policies that benefit Nigerians while offering constructive feedback on areas requiring improvement.

The governor cited his extensive experience as a former Federal Capital Territory Minister, a two-term governor, and Chairman of the PDP Governors Forum as the basis for his insights into governance and policy-making.

“Governor Bala’s critique of the Tax Reform Bills stems from a commitment to inclusive governance and the understanding that effective reforms require broad-based consultation,” the statement read.

Governor Mohammed also highlighted President Tinubu’s legacy as a pro-democracy advocate and reiterated his respect for the presidency. However, he emphasized that respect in a democracy does not preclude constructive criticism.

The statement further addressed remarks made by Sunday Dare, Special Adviser to the President on Media and Public Communication, urging professionalism and diplomacy in public discourse to foster unity and focus on critical national issues.

Governor Mohammed called for collaborative efforts toward addressing Nigeria’s challenges while maintaining respect and accountability in democratic governance.
